DuPont™ Tyvek® Industry coveralls – Two-way Protection for Demanding Applications

DuPont™ Tyvek® Industry coveralls help protect both wearers from hazards and processes and products from human contamination, all without compromising on comfort.

These garments are ideal for workers in sensitive industrial environments that require high standards for particle and microbiological contamination control.

Safety and comfort benefits include:

•    Chemical protective clothing – category III, type 5 and 6
•    Particle inward leakage of 3% according to Type 5*
•    Class 1 radioactive particulate protection according to EN 1073-2
•    Fabric permeation protection against some water-based inorganic low concentration chemicals
•    Electrostatic properties according to EN 1149-5 (both sides)**
•    Robust; highly resistant to abrasion and tear
•    Inherent barrier protection and protection in use
•    Good breathability thanks to both air and moisture vapour permeability
•    Tough yet extremely light, soft and comfortable
•    Extremely low-linting and silicon-free fabric properties
•    10 year shelf life (with the exception of electrostatic performance)

Excellent fit for enhanced protection:

•    Internally stitched seams reduce the risk of contamination by the garment, reducing particle penetration from inside the garment to the outside
•    Tyvek® auto-lock zipper and zip flap for increased tightness
•    The elasticated waist is not glued-in.
•    Elasticated cuffs and ankles for an ideal fit (latex-free)

Applications: help protect people and processes in the food, optical and electronics industries as well as during general manufacturing and when performing dirty jobs.

Available in white. Sizes: S to XXXL

* with additional taping at the ankles, cuffs and mask of a separate hood
** The antistatic treatment of suits is only effective in humidity of more than 25% and when the wearer and suit are correctly grounded. The antistatic properties may reduce over time. The user must ensure that the dissipative performance is sufficient for the application. Stay away from heat, flame and sparks. Refer to the product instructions for use.
